Berthold Maria Schenk Graf von Stauffenberg

German retired Bundeswehr general (born 1934)

Berthold Maria Schenk Graf von Stauffenberg is a German retired Bundeswehr general. Early in his career, he commanded Germany's largest military base. At the time of his retirement in 1994 he was Germany's longest serving soldier, having served in the Heer (Army) for thirty-eight years. He is the son of World War II colonel and resistance leader Claus von Stauffenberg.
